Black Creek town, North Carolina: commercial real estate data.

Black Creek town is a Census town of 749 people across 0.71 square miles of land, in Wilson County. Median household income is $53,750, 60.1 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 1 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$734,000.

How many people live in Black Creek, North Carolina?

749, in 293 households. Black Creek town covers 0.71 square miles of land, which is 1,058 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Black Creek in?

Wilson County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Black Creek?

$53,750.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$112,200. Median gross rent is $868 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
